Description:
Driver chip: SH1122
Interface: 4-wire SPI
Resolution: 256*64
Display size: 2.08 inches
Display color: White
OLED mode: negative, fully transparent
Grayscale type: supports 16 Levels of Crayscale
Working temperature: -40°C~70°C
Storage temperature: -40°C~85°C
Working voltage: 3.0-5V
Module sizes: 75.5mm×19.35mm×5.9mm
Viewing area: 53.18mm×14.78mm
Effective area: 51.18mm×12.78mm
Point distance: 0.20mm×0.20mm
Dot size: 0.18mm×0.18mmPin Definition:
1. GND power supply negative terminal
2. VIN power supply positive
3. SCL clock
4. SDA data
5. RES reset
6. DC commands/data
7. DS Chip selection
